## Deployment

Schemaden is deployed via the standard Flintrock pipeline — push a tag, the registry pods roll one at a time. Compatibility checks run before each pod comes up, so a bad schema bundle will stall the rollout rather than break consumers (you're welcome).

If paged mid-deploy, check the validator logs first. The deploy-time configuration values are below.

service settings:
[pelius]
port = 5432
team = praius
host = pelius.crelvoforge.internal
region = upper-4
access_code = ac_8f224d
timeout_ms = 2000

Subject: DR drill Thursday — fuel report access

Hey support crew,

Quick heads-up: Thursday's disaster-recovery drill at Pellway Logistics will take the FuelTally dashboard offline for about an hour. If customers ask about the weekly fleet fuel-usage report, let them know it'll regenerate automatically once the standby cluster in Dorrin Falls picks up. You shouldn't need to do anything manual, but just in case the vault prompts you during failover, use the drill passphrase below.

vault phrase of bagaf-kajeg = jorath-feniel-briir-siliel-ralix

## v4.12.3 — Key rotation for autocomplete index signer

While investigating the slow autocomplete index rebuild in Quellstrom's suggest service, we found the stale signer from the 2023 rotation was still validating shards, adding a verification retry loop on every merge. This patch rotates to the new signer and removes the retry path; rebuild time dropped from 41 to 9 minutes in staging at Bryncote. Reviewers: please confirm the old key is revoked everywhere. The replacement signing key for the index publisher is below.

signing key of bagap-yawep = bky13_TbfT6ZMUoGJo2